Koh Kood Beach Resort
Thai and Western dishes are served in an open-air beachfront restaurant at a resort with bungalows and a pool. The vegan menu features tofu and various traditional Thai dishes, though some guests report inconsistencies with vegan preparation. Guests appreciate the scenic sea views at sunset and acknowledge reasonable food prices for the island. Service experience varies with reports of both helpful and occasionally dismissive staff toward dietary requests.

Some users reported cross-contamination — worth asking about sauces before ordering.
Others mentioned hidden animal ingredients in dishes labeled vegan — ask about sauces and broths.
A few noted inconsistent vegan claims on the menu.
